WASHINGTON DC — The Supreme Court allowed President Donald Trump to continue building a new ballroom adjacent to the White House, at least for now. Chief Justice John Roberts issued a temporary stay that blocks lower court rulings that would have halted the above-ground portion of the project. However, the decision is only provisional and gives the justices more time to consider the next steps. The legal challenge was brought by the National Trust for Historic Preservation, which argued that the president did not have the authority to proceed with the construction and objected, on aesthetic grounds, to the large design of the new ballroom.
